    It means something depending on opponent's style. Like if we say Hatton was the bigger guy going in against Marquez then sure it will be a problem because of his aggressive style. Mayweather doesn't use his size to his advantage and has made a career fighting bigger guys anyway, Mayweather relies on defense, movement and speed. He doesn't overpower opponents for size to be a factor.

    People thought DLH, Hatton and now Cotto will trouble Pac due to their size and their styles which usually relies on overpowering opponents and charging in. Mayweather doesn't fight like those guys for size to be a huge advantage for him.

    Larger or not, he will take a punch from someone that's weighed in the same as he did. If it's unfair in any way the fight won't be allowed.
